What La Légende de Zatoïchi, Vol. 25 : Retour au pays natal is
You walk back to your childhood village and meet Omiyo, who shares a wet-nurse with you. An old friend, Shinbei, greets you with wealth and vague recognition. He offers to clear village debts, but the deal hinges on a valuable rock quarry. Subtle tension thickens as the earth beneath your feet shifts. Yasuda wastes no motion, letting the swordplay decide who owns the ground.
